What to do if you lose your pet in Kearny, state of New Jersey?

When your pet goes missing in Kearny, it's essential to act quickly and efficiently. Here are some steps you can take:

  • Search your home and yard thoroughly. Pets often hide in unexpected spots.
  • Notify your local animal control and shelters. They can assist in locating lost pets.
  • Check with your neighbors, as they might have seen your lost pet.
  • Utilize social media platforms and local online groups to post about your missing animal.
  • Print flyers with your pet's photo and description, and distribute them around your neighborhood.

These steps can significantly enhance the chances of finding your lost pet. Acting promptly is crucial since the sooner you start searching, the better the chance that your pet will be found safe.

How to write a missing pet ad in Kearny, state of New Jersey?

Writing an effective ad for your missing pet can make a difference in quickly getting help. Here’s how to craft a compelling ad:

  • Include a clear and recent photo of your pet, showcasing any distinctive features.
  • Write a descriptive title, like "Missing Dog - %breed% from Kearny!"
  • Provide details such as your pet's name, breed, color, and any identifiable markings.
  • State the date and location where they were last seen, offering context for potential finders.
  • Include your contact information and any reward details, if applicable.

By following these guidelines, you can create an advertisement that captures attention and encourages community support in finding your beloved pet.
